Вопрос задан 20.06.2023 в 14:51. Предмет Информатика. Спрашивает Филатов Ваня.

ДАЮ 30 БАЛООВ. Сколько единиц в двоичном представлении числа. 2^45−2^23+1 ? В ответе запиши

только число.
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Мусабаев Дильмухаммед.

Ответ:

23

Объяснение:

прикрепил код на питоне, мы задаем функцию перевода из одной сс в другую, после пишем наше выражение и указываем то, что нужно найти


0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Для решения данной задачи нужно вычислить значение выражения 2^45 - 2^23 + 1 и перевести полученное число в двоичную систему счисления.

Сначала посчитаем выражение: 2^45 = 35 184 372 088 832 2^23 = 8 388 608 Таким образом, 2^45 - 2^23 = 35 184 372 088 832 - 8 388 608 = 35 176 983 480 224. Добавляем 1: 35 176 983 480 224 + 1 = 35 176 983 480 225.

Теперь переведем полученное число в двоичную систему счисления: Для этого делим число на 2 и записываем остаток. Затем делим полученное частное на 2 и снова записываем остаток. Продолжаем делить полученные частные на 2 и записывать остатки до тех пор, пока частное не станет равным 0.

35 176 983 480 225 / 2 = 17 588 491 740 112 (остаток: 1) 17 588 491 740 112 / 2 = 8 794 245 870 056 (остаток: 0) 8 794 245 870 056 / 2 = 4 397 122 935 028 (остаток: 0) 4 397 122 935 028 / 2 = 2 198 561 467 514 (остаток: 0) 2 198 561 467 514 / 2 = 1 099 280 733 757 (остаток: 0) 1 099 280 733 757 / 2 = 549 640 366 878 (остаток: 1) 549 640 366 878 / 2 = 274 820 183 439 (остаток: 0) 274 820 183 439 / 2 = 137 410 091 719 (остаток: 1) 137 410 091 719 / 2 = 68 705 045 859 (остаток: 1) 68 705 045 859 / 2 = 34 352 522 929 (остаток: 1) 34 352 522 929 / 2 = 17 176 261 464 (остаток: 0) 17 176 261 464 / 2 = 8 588 130 732 (остаток: 0) 8 588 130 732 / 2 = 4 294 065 366 (остаток: 0) 4 294 065 366 / 2 = 2 147 032 683 (остаток: 0) 2 147 032 683 / 2 = 1 073 516 341 (остаток: 1) 1 073 516 341 / 2 = 536 758 170 (остаток: 0) 536 758 170 / 2 = 268 379 085 (остаток: 0) 268 379 085 / 2 = 134 189 542 (остаток: 0) 134 189 542 / 2 = 67 094 771 (остаток: 1) 67 094 771 / 2 = 33 547 385 (остаток: 1) 33 547 385 / 2 = 16 773 692 (остаток: 0) 16 773 692 / 2 = 8 386 846 (остаток: 0) 8 386 846 / 2 = 4 193 423 (остаток: 1) 4 193 423 / 2 = 2 096 711 (остаток: 1) 2 096 711 / 2 = 1 048 355 (остаток: 1) 1 048 355 / 2 = 524 177 (остаток: 1) 524 177 / 2 = 262 088 (остаток: 0) 262 088 / 2 = 131 044 (остаток: 0) 131 044 / 2 = 65 522 (остаток: 0) 65 522 / 2 = 32 761 (остаток: 0) 32 761 / 2 = 16 380 (остаток: 0) 16 380 / 2 = 8 190 (остаток: 0) 8 190 / 2 = 4 095 (остаток: 1) 4 095 / 2 = 2 047 (остаток: 1) 2 047 / 2 = 1 023 (остаток: 1) 1 023 / 2 = 511 (остаток: 1) 511 / 2 = 255 (остаток: 1) 255 / 2 = 127 (остаток: 1) 127 / 2 = 63 (остаток: 1) 63 / 2 = 31 (остаток: 1) 31 / 2 = 15 (остаток: 1) 15 / 2 = 7 (остаток: 1) 7 / 2 = 3 (остаток: 1) 3 / 2 = 1 (остаток: 1) 1 / 2 = 0 (остаток: 1)

Таким образом, число 35 176 983 480 225 в двоичной системе счисления будет записываться как 1000000000000000000000000000000000000000000000001.

Ответ: 1000000000000000000000000000000000000000000000001

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ос